• 技术文章 >数据库 >mysql教程

    命令行怎么设置mysql编码格式?

    青灯夜游青灯夜游2020-09-30 14:56:50原创115

    命令行设置mysql编码格式的方法:1、在命令行中登录mysql,进入mysql命令行编辑模式;2、使用SET命令来设置mysql编码格式,语法“set character_set_..=utf8”。

    问题描述:使用JDBC向mysql插入数据时中文乱码(中文以?显示)

    解决思路:eclipse以及eclipse中每个java文件和编码须和mysql数据库一致,都设为utf8。注:mysql仅安装和建表时设置为utf-8还不够

    1、登录mysql

    1.png

    命令行下进入mysql安装路径下的bin目录下,进入mysql命令行编辑模式

    2、SHOW VARIABLES LIKE 'character_set_%'查看各项编码格式

    3、使用SET命令依次把不是utf-8的格式改成utf-8;

    set character_set_client=utf8; // 设置客户端的编码为utf8

    set character_set_connection=utf8; //

    set character_set_database=utf8; //

    set character_set_results=utf8; //

    set character_set_server=utf8; //

    set character_set_system=utf8; //


    4、SHOW VARIABLES LIKE 'character_set_%'; 再次查看确认.

    1.jpg

    5、最后exit; 完成

    (推荐教程:mysql视频教程

    以上就是命令行怎么设置mysql编码格式?的详细内容,更多请关注php中文网其它相关文章!

    本文原创发布php中文网,转载请注明出处,感谢您的尊重!
    专题推荐:mysql
    上一篇:mysql怎么去除主键约束 下一篇:mysql官网如何下载源码包?
    第14期线上培训班

    相关文章推荐

    • 怎么查看mysql的用户名和密码• mysql如何实现批量删除• Mysql如何允许外网访问设置• mysql使用索引时需要注意什么• 如何查看mysql语句的运行时间• cmd如何解决mysql乱码• mysql怎么删除触发器

    全部评论我要评论

  • 取消发布评论发送
  • 1/1

    PHP中文网